Clock Buffers, Drivers Intersil (Renesas Electronics Corporation) 2309NZ-1HDCGI Overview

The Clock Buffers, Drivers Intersil (Renesas Electronics Corporation) 2309NZ-1HDCGI is an integral component for managing clock signals within high-performance systems. Designed for precision and reliability, this IC clock buffer efficiently distributes a single input clock signal into nine outputs at a frequency of up to 133.33 MHz. Its incorporation in a 16SOIC package enables compact and efficient design solutions, suitable for modern electronic applications requiring consistent timing across multiple components.
